Cable Techniques CT-LPXR Overview

With its distinguishing yellow cap color, the Low-Profile, 3-Pin XLR Female to 3-Pin XLR Male Cable from Cable Techniques is a 10" XLR cable with an angle-adjustable, cable-outlet orientation. You can adjust the cable outlet from 30 to 150°, as well as the release-button angle from 210 to 330°, to better suit whichever device you're hooking into, be it a Sound Devices unit (the 633, 688, 788T, 302, and 552, for example), a Zaxcom device, a piece of Zoom gear, or other such location-audio kits. Lightweight at 1.5 oz, the cable has been built to promote minimal intrusion and preserve durability with its rugged, 3.2mm cable-jacket diameter and crush- and tear-resistant cable material. 

Cable Techniques CT-LPXR Specs

Cable Length
10" / 25.4 cm
Outer Diameter
0.1" / 3.2 mm
Shielding
Braid
Jacket Type
Polyurethane
